What type of molecule regulates cellular functions?

Hormones are critical molecules in the body that regulate a wide range of cellular functions. They function as signaling molecules, produced in one location and transported through the bloodstream to target cells or organs, where they elicit specific physiological responses. This regulatory role encompasses various processes, including metabolism, growth, immune response, and mood, among others.

While enzymes, proteins, and carbohydrates play essential roles in cellular processes, they do not primarily serve as direct regulators of cellular functions in the way hormones do. Enzymes act as catalysts for biochemical reactions, proteins perform structural and functional roles within cells, and carbohydrates serve mainly as energy sources or structural components. However, hormones, by definition, specifically control and coordinate different biological functions, showcasing their unique role in cellular regulation.
